15 And in those days Peter stood up in the midst of the disciples (altogether the number of names was about a hundred and twenty), and said, 16 “Men and brethren, this Scripture had to be fulfilled, which the Holy Spirit spoke before by the mouth of David concerning Judas, who became a guide to those who arrested Jesus; 17 for he was numbered with us and obtained a part in this ministry.”
1:15
And in those days
“Those days” indicates that the 11 and others stayed in the upper room until they chose the replacement apostle for Judas.
Peter stood up in the midst of the disciples
Peter was the leader and spokesman for the 11. This leadership does not imply that he possessed sole authority over the group.
(altogether the number of names was about a hundred and twenty), and said,
Peter’s first speech was to approximately 120 believers in the upper room.
1:16
“Men and brethren, this Scripture had to [divine necessity] be fulfilled,
Peter viewed Scripture as mandating the replacement of Judas by another apostle. He referred to two imprecatory psalms of David (Acts 1:20; cf. Pss 69:25; 109:8). His use of Scripture shows his respect for biblical revelation.
which the Holy Spirit spoke before by the mouth of David concerning Judas,
The Holy Spirit spoke through the mouth of David about the future of Judas.
who became a guide to those who arrested Jesus;
Judas guided the enemies of Christ to the Lord and betrayed Him.
1:17
for he was numbered with us and obtained a part in this ministry.”
Judas had a role in the ministry of the 12. For this betrayer to fulfill his role as a “guide,” it was determined that he had a share in their ministry. However, this man was not an authentic believer (Jn 6:64) but a thief (Jn 12:6) and a devil (Jn 6:70-71).
